Transaction 31f7216db9c848fd73823763c98d15ad430fbd68c0039b2ad8a7e1e3d5514e1a
1 Input
1 Output
-
31f7216db9c848fd73823763c98d15ad430fbd68c0039b2ad8a7e1e3d5514e1a:0
- value
- 58962321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54bf6264067c723382ce3e9734a61641618ee565 OP_EQUAL
- address
- MFdGGAHbn6AQt6ECX33gkTbMPQmZ2j3PWg